<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="">I believe the intake
manifolds left the factory painted the same
Healey Green as the engine. In any event, I
painted mine with the Moss spray can engine
paint in 1999 and it's still fine. The intake
manifold doesn't get that hot. The key to any
paint durability is how clean the surface is
when you paint it.</span></div>

<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t;">I’m
interested in my options for finishing my
intake manifold. It was powder coated clear
12 years ago, and the coating has yellowed at
the head flanges from heat, and over the years
what look like rust spots have developed in
the powder coat, which is odd since the
manifold is cast aluminum (see the attached
photo).</span></div>
<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t;"> </span></div>
<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t;">I’d prefer
to preserve the natural cast aluminum color,
and I’m not a big fan of the chrome or
polished look on the intake (my apologies to
all you out there with nice shiny intake
manifolds—it’s just not my taste). I had the
exhaust manifold Jet-Hot coated in a cast iron
gray 12 years ago, and they still look great.
So, Jet-Hot coating the intake is one option,
but the color samples they sent me of their
lightest grays are all at best a medium gray;
all considerably darker than their online
color catalogue indicates. I’m going to call
them Monday, but I’m not sure they have a
coating light enough.</span></div>
<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t;"> </span></div>
<div class="yiv3133065192M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t;">I also
don’t want to paint it, as I know that won’t
hold up long term. I’m curious about blasting
the clear powder coat off and leaving the
manifold uncoated. How does the “naked”
aluminum hold up to the heat? What have
others done? Your experience is appreciated.</span></div>
